The fash pack are well and truly off on the last part of their month-long trip to the fashion capitals of the world – last stop, Paris! Some say Paris is where the big guns come out, and it’s not hard to see why with the likes of Chanel, Dior, Valentino and Balenciaga among those which show their collections in the French capital.

Before the aforementioned big guns come out to play though, other collections from the likes of  Rochas, Dries Van Noten, Alexis Mabille and Anthony Vaccarello helped kick Paris Fashion Week off in style, offering a host of versatile and truly memorable pieces for the new autumn/winter 2013 season.

It was flirty fifties silhouettes galore at Rochas (with a stunning Olivia Palermo sitting pretty on the front row, no less) while it was all about the 80s style goth over at Alexis Mabille – teamed with stunning scarlet lips, obviously! We loved the sexy, daring pieces at Anthony Vaccarello, and if you think the one-sided flesh-flashing looks familiar, it might be because he was the mastermind behind the dress Jennifer Lopez wore to the Grammys earlier this month.
